What’s more, a SiC device can be a lot less than a tenth the thickness of the silicon device but have the same voltage rating, because the voltage difference does not have to become unfold across as much material. These thinner devices are faster and boast fewer resistance, which means much less energy is dropped to heat when a silicon carbide diode or transistor is conducting electricity.

Mixing and Heating: At first, silica sand and petroleum coke are mixed in a specific ratio. This combination is then heated to temperatures previously mentioned 2,200°C in an electric resistance furnace. At these high temperatures, a reaction occurs between silicon and carbon to form SiC.

Abrasives and Cutting Tools: SiC’s hardness and toughness make it an excellent abrasive material, widely used in grinding wheels, sandpapers, and cutting tools.

Ensuring consistent quality in SiC can be a significant challenge. Variations in crystal structure may lead to differences in properties, impacting its performance in different applications. Continuous research is being conducted to refine the production process for uniform quality.

Type 27 is undoubtedly the most common abrasive grinding wheel. Type 27 grinding wheels differ from other wheels in that they have a flat profile with a depressed center. A depressed center allows for clearance when the operator should work in a constrained angle.

The structure is crystalline, with silicon and carbon atoms arranged within a tetrahedral lattice. This arrangement provides the material its impressive strength and thermal stability.

The market rewards vertical integration, as evidenced from the dominance from the mostly integrated leading players. According to our analysis, vertical integration in SiC wafer and device manufacturing can improve yield by 5 to ten percentage points and margins by 10 to fifteen percentage points,7Compared to some combination of pure-play providers across these segments from the value chain.
